Job Summary
The News Reporter will be responsible for researching, investigating, writing, and presenting news stories across multiple platforms. The role requires excellent communication skills, strong journalistic ethics, and the ability to work under tight deadlines while ensuring accuracy and credibility.
Key Responsibilities
- Research, investigate, and report on local, national, and regional news stories.
- Cover breaking news, political events, press conferences, social events, crime, education, business, healthcare, and community issues.
- Conduct interviews with public officials, industry experts, and other relevant sources.
- Verify facts and ensure the accuracy, fairness, and credibility of every news report.
- Write clear, concise, and engaging news scripts and articles.
- Present news reports confidently on camera whenever required.
- Coordinate with camera operators, producers, editors, and the editorial team during assignments.
- Capture photos, videos, and supporting content from the field when necessary.
- Maintain strong relationships with reliable news sources and government departments.
- Stay updated with current affairs, industry developments, and emerging trends.
- Follow editorial policies, journalistic ethics, and legal guidelines.
- Meet daily, weekly, and monthly reporting targets.
